Learning Outcomes 
    1. This course systematically develops translation skills: the ability to recognise the register, meaning, and cultural import of a German text, and to render that text appropriately in English.  
2. Students will also practice Précis writing in German: the ability to summarise a text in German on a journalistic or cultural topic.  
3. In the Language Practical students will develop their fluency in spoken German and their presentation skills.
